Background: Loss of function (LoF) variants in GRIN2B lead to neurodevelopmental delay, which is expected to be mediated by alterations in the excitation-inhibition (E/I) balance resulting from reduced activity of the N-Methyl-D-Aspartate receptor. To test this hypothesis, we use quantitative electroencephalogram to provide insights into network-level estimates of the excitation-inhibition ratio.
